What is a College Admissions Consultant?

HelloCollege

This can include creating a balanced college list, developing a strategic application plan, offering feedback on essays, preparing for interviews, and providing advice on the Common App activities list. The goal is to help students present or “package” themselves in the best possible light to admissions counselors.
